CITYWIDE RE-ROUTING OF GARBAGE AREAS COMING IN JULY

April 20, 2007 -- On July 1, 2007, the City of Houston will be converting the areas that were previously serviced under contract with Republic Waste to direct service by the City’s Solid Waste Management Department (SWMD). To incorporate these new customers most efficiently, the boundaries of the SWMD service centers have changed and the entire city will be re-routed to optimize efficiency and reduce cost.

In order to take maximum advantage of the route optimization, some customers will experience a service day change for automated garbage and yard trimmings collection beginning July 1st.

Residents who will experience a service day change will receive a letter in June notifying them of the change. “We also are providing the information on our website in June for everyone to confirm their service days”, said Buck Buchanan, SWMD Director. The Solid Waste Management Department’s website is www.houstonsolidwaste.org.
